Transaction 873b21e98346b151a1f0755e6e36476366809519edbf10856024d9e54fbaf9b9

1 Input
2 Outputs
  • 873b21e98346b151a1f0755e6e36476366809519edbf10856024d9e54fbaf9b9:0
  • value  20657600000
    address  14fGsNVyvwjpuE3oSXnf4dMT6YfBJpQhmk
  • 873b21e98346b151a1f0755e6e36476366809519edbf10856024d9e54fbaf9b9:1
  • value  11000000
    address  1S2JE9Pep4vbM5nvt4MsdJY5U1Ven3GCW